(B) THE WIDOW OF EVERY JUDGE WHO DIES IN ACTIVE
SERVICE SHALL BE PAID TWO-THIRDS OF THE PENSION TO
WHICH SUCH JUDGE WOULD HAVE BEEN ENTITLED ON
THE DATE OF HIS DEATH IF HE HAD BEEN ELIGIBLE FOR
RETIREMENT AND HAD RETIRED ON SAID DATE IRRE-
SPECTIVE OF WHETHER HE SHALL HAVE ATTAINED THE
AGE OF SIXTY-FIVE (65) AT THE TIME OF HIS DEATH. THE
WIDOW OF EVERY SUCH JUDGE WHO DIES AFTER RETIR-
ING SHALL BE PAID TWO-THIRDS OF THE PENSION WHICH
SUCH JUDGE WAS RECEIVING AT THE DATE OF HIS DEATH.
IN ORDER TO BE ENTITLED TO THE PENSION PROVIDED
BY THIS SECTION, A WIDOW OF A JUDGE WHO DIES DUR-
ING ACTIVE SERVICE SHALL HAVE BEEN MARRIED TO HIM
FOR A PERIOD OF NOT LESS THAN THREE YEARS BEFORE
HIS RETIREMENT. A WIDOW WHO IS ENTITLED TO A PEN-
SION UNDER THE PROVISIONS OF THIS SECTION SHALL
BE PAID FOR THE PERIOD OF HER LIFE UNLESS SHE RE-
MARRIES, IN WHICH EVENT THE PENSION IS TO CEASE
AND TERMINATE.

Sec. 2. And be it further enacted, That this Act shall take effect
July 1, 1968.

Approved April 10, 1968.

CHAPTER 248
(House Bill 492)

AN ACT to repeal and re-enact, with amendments, Section 28-1 of
Article 33 of the Annotated Code of Maryland (1967 Replacement
Volume and 1967 Supplement), title "Election Code" subtitle
"Uniform Act for Voting by Nonresidents in Presidential Elec-
tions," to affect the residency requirements for voting for presi-
dential and vice-presidential electors.

Section 1.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Maryland,
That Section 28-1 of Article 33 of the Annotated Code of Maryland
(1967 Replacement Volume and 1967 Supplement), title "Election
Code" subtitle "Uniform Act of Voting by Nonresidents in Presiden-
tial Elections," be and the same is hereby repealed and re-enacted,
with amendments, to read as follows:
